
检验结果溯源算法研究-洞察剖析.pptx
36页检验结果溯源算法研究,溯源算法原理分析 检验结果数据结构 算法模型构建 实时性优化策略 算法性能评估方法 数据安全与隐私保护 溯源算法应用场景 源码优化与性能提升,Contents Page,目录页,溯源算法原理分析,检验结果溯源算法研究,溯源算法原理分析,1.基于数学建模,溯源算法需考虑数据关联性、时间序列分析和概率统计等数学工具,构建一个能够有效追踪数据来源的模型2.模型应具备可扩展性,以适应不同规模和复杂度的溯源需求,如大规模数据集的快速检索和分析3.结合机器学习算法,通过训练数据集不断优化模型,提高溯源的准确性和效率溯源算法的数据预处理,1.数据预处理是溯源算法的关键步骤,包括数据清洗、去重、标准化和特征提取等,以确保溯源过程的准确性和效率2.针对异构数据源,预处理应考虑数据的多样性,采用适配的预处理策略,如多模态数据的融合处理3.数据预处理还应考虑数据隐私保护,采用匿名化或加密技术,确保溯源过程的安全性溯源算法的数学模型构建,溯源算法原理分析,溯源算法的关联规则挖掘,1.关联规则挖掘是溯源算法的核心技术之一,通过分析数据之间的关联性,揭示数据来源和传播路径2.算法需具备高效率的关联规则挖掘能力,支持实时溯源,尤其是在处理实时数据流时。
3.结合深度学习技术,实现更复杂的关联规则挖掘,提高溯源的深度和广度溯源算法的时间序列分析,1.时间序列分析在溯源算法中用于追踪数据随时间的变化规律,揭示数据流动的时间线索2.算法应能够处理非平稳时间序列数据,采用自适应或自适应调整的方法,提高溯源的准确性3.结合时间序列预测技术,对未来的数据流动趋势进行预测,增强溯源的预见性溯源算法原理分析,溯源算法的机器学习优化,1.机器学习技术可应用于溯源算法的优化,通过学习大量的溯源数据,提高算法的性能和适应性2.采用监督学习、无监督学习或半监督学习等方法,根据不同数据特点选择合适的机器学习模型3.结合深度学习技术,如卷积神经网络(CNN)和循环神经网络(RNN),实现更复杂的特征提取和模式识别溯源算法的安全性与隐私保护,1.溯源算法在设计时需充分考虑安全性,防止溯源信息被恶意篡改或泄露2.采用加密、数字签名和访问控制等技术,确保溯源过程的机密性和完整性3.遵循数据保护法规,对个人隐私数据进行匿名化处理,确保溯源过程中个人隐私不被侵犯检验结果数据结构,检验结果溯源算法研究,检验结果数据结构,检验结果数据结构设计原则,1.标准化:检验结果数据结构应遵循相关国家标准和行业标准,确保数据的统一性和可互操作性。
2.层次化:数据结构应具备清晰的层次结构,便于数据管理和查询,同时适应不同层级的数据需求3.扩展性:设计时应考虑未来可能的数据增长和业务扩展,保证数据结构的灵活性和适应性检验结果数据类型与格式,1.数据类型多样性:检验结果数据应涵盖文本、数值、图像等多种类型,以满足不同检验项目的需求2.数据格式规范性:数据格式需符合统一的规范,如XML、JSON等,以保证数据的一致性和易解析性3.数据编码一致性:采用统一的编码方式,如UTF-8,以避免字符编码问题导致的错误检验结果数据结构,检验结果数据索引与存储,1.索引策略优化:根据数据特点选择合适的索引策略,如B树、哈希索引等,以提高数据检索效率2.数据存储安全性:采用安全的数据存储方案,如加密存储、备份策略等,确保数据的安全性和可靠性3.数据扩展能力:存储系统应具备良好的扩展性,以适应数据量的增长和业务需求的变化检验结果数据质量控制,1.数据校验机制:建立数据校验机制,对输入和输出的数据进行校验,确保数据的准确性和完整性2.数据清洗流程:实施数据清洗流程,去除错误数据和不一致数据,提高数据质量3.数据审核制度:建立数据审核制度,确保数据在存储和传输过程中的准确性。
检验结果数据结构,检验结果数据集成与交换,1.集成策略选择:根据实际需求选择合适的集成策略,如ETL(Extract,Transform,Load)、API等,实现数据集成2.交换标准制定:制定数据交换标准,如HL7、FHIR等,确保不同系统间的数据交换顺畅3.数据接口设计:设计合理的数据接口,实现不同系统间的数据互操作,提高数据交换效率检验结果数据分析与应用,1.数据分析模型:建立适用于检验结果数据的特点分析模型,如聚类分析、关联规则挖掘等,挖掘数据价值2.数据可视化技术:运用数据可视化技术,将检验结果数据以图表等形式展现,便于用户理解和分析3.业务应用场景:结合实际业务场景,将检验结果数据应用于决策支持、风险预警等方面,提升业务价值算法模型构建,检验结果溯源算法研究,算法模型构建,1.框架设计应遵循系统化、模块化原则,确保算法模型的稳定性和可扩展性2.框架应包含数据预处理、特征提取、模型训练、模型评估和结果溯源等关键模块3.采用先进的数据处理技术,如数据清洗、归一化和降维,以提高模型处理大数据的能力数据预处理策略,1.针对检验结果数据,实施数据清洗,包括去除异常值、填补缺失值等2.采用数据归一化技术,将不同量纲的数据转化为同一尺度,便于模型处理。
3.通过数据降维技术,如主成分分析(PCA),减少数据维度,提高计算效率检验结果溯源算法模型构建的框架设计,算法模型构建,特征提取方法研究,1.研究基于深度学习的特征提取方法,如卷积神经网络(CNN)和循环神经网络(RNN),以挖掘数据中的隐含特征2.探索基于统计学的特征提取方法,如主成分分析(PCA)和因子分析,以降低数据维度并提取关键特征3.结合领域知识,设计针对检验结果数据的专业特征提取方法模型训练策略,1.采用先进的机器学习算法,如支持向量机(SVM)、随机森林(RF)和神经网络(NN),以提高模型性能2.实施交叉验证技术,确保模型在未知数据上的泛化能力3.利用生成模型,如变分自编码器(VAE),进行特征学习和数据生成算法模型构建,模型评估与优化,1.设计多指标评估体系,包括准确率、召回率、F1值等,全面评估模型性能2.采用网格搜索、贝叶斯优化等策略,对模型参数进行优化3.对模型进行敏感性分析,以识别影响模型性能的关键因素结果溯源策略,1.基于模型输出,实现检验结果的溯源,包括数据来源、处理过程和决策依据2.利用可视化技术,如热力图和决策树,展示溯源过程,提高可解释性3.结合领域知识,对溯源结果进行验证和修正,确保溯源结果的准确性。
实时性优化策略,检验结果溯源算法研究,实时性优化策略,数据流处理技术,1.数据流处理技术在实时性优化中扮演关键角色,通过高速数据处理能力,实现对检验结果的即时响应2.采用流式计算框架,如Apache Flink或Spark Streaming,能够有效地处理和分析连续的检验数据流,确保数据处理的实时性3.技术趋势表明,边缘计算与数据流处理结合,能够进一步缩短数据处理时间,提升实时性,尤其是在远程或分布式检验环境中分布式计算架构,1.分布式计算架构能够通过多个节点协同处理大量数据,提高检验结果溯源算法的实时性2.利用如Kubernetes等容器编排技术,实现计算资源的动态分配和优化,确保系统在高负载下仍能保持实时性3.前沿技术如人工智能与分布式计算的结合,如使用TensorFlow on Kubernetes,可以进一步提高数据处理的速度和效率实时性优化策略,1.内存计算优化策略通过减少数据在磁盘和网络中的传输,显著提升数据处理速度,从而优化实时性2.使用内存数据库如Redis或Memcached,能够快速读取和写入数据,降低数据访问延迟3.内存计算优化策略在处理高并发请求时尤为有效,能够保证检验结果溯源算法的实时响应。
缓存机制,1.缓存机制通过存储频繁访问的数据,减少对底层存储系统的访问,从而提高数据处理速度2.利用LRU(Least Recently Used)等缓存替换策略,确保缓存中的数据始终是最相关的,提高实时性3.随着大数据量的增加,分布式缓存系统如Apache Ignite等成为趋势,能够支持大规模数据的实时缓存处理内存计算优化,实时性优化策略,并行处理与任务调度,1.并行处理技术能够将复杂任务分解为多个子任务,并行执行,显著提升数据处理速度2.任务调度算法如MapReduce或Spark的弹性调度,能够根据系统负载动态调整任务分配,保证实时性3.在检验结果溯源算法中,并行处理与任务调度相结合,能够有效应对大规模数据集的处理,保持实时性算法优化与模型简化,1.针对检验结果溯源算法进行优化,减少算法复杂度,提高计算效率2.采用轻量级模型,如使用深度学习中的知识蒸馏技术,简化模型结构,保持性能的同时提升实时性3.前沿研究如神经网络剪枝和量化技术,能够在不显著影响准确性的前提下,减少模型参数和计算量,优化实时性算法性能评估方法,检验结果溯源算法研究,算法性能评估方法,算法准确率评估,1.准确率是评估算法性能最直接和常用的指标,特别是对于分类任务。
准确率计算公式为:准确率=(正确预测数/总预测数)100%2.在实际应用中,需要考虑数据集的分布情况,避免过拟合或欠拟合可以通过交叉验证等方法来提高评估的可靠性3.随着深度学习等复杂模型的兴起,准确率不再是唯一指标,需要结合其他指标如F1分数、召回率等综合评估算法效率评估,1.算法效率是指算法在处理数据时所需的计算资源和时间评估方法包括时间复杂度和空间复杂度分析2.实际应用中,算法的效率直接影响系统的响应速度和资源消耗可以通过基准测试来评估算法在不同规模数据上的性能3.随着大数据和云计算的发展,算法的效率评估越来越注重并行处理和分布式计算的能力算法性能评估方法,算法鲁棒性评估,1.算法鲁棒性是指算法在面对异常数据或噪声时的稳定性和可靠性2.评估方法包括在数据集中引入异常值或噪声,观察算法的表现常用的指标有误报率、漏报率等3.随着人工智能在复杂环境中的应用,算法的鲁棒性成为关键考量因素算法可解释性评估,1.算法可解释性是指算法决策过程的透明度和可理解性2.评估方法包括分析算法内部结构、流程和参数设置,以及通过可视化技术展示算法的决策路径3.随着对算法透明度的要求提高,可解释性评估成为评估算法性能的重要方面。
算法性能评估方法,算法泛化能力评估,1.算法泛化能力是指算法在新数据集上的表现,反映了算法的适应性和学习能力2.评估方法包括使用未见过的数据集对算法进行测试,观察其预测准确率3.随着数据量的增加和多样性,算法的泛化能力成为衡量其应用价值的关键指标算法公平性评估,1.算法公平性是指算法在处理不同群体数据时的一致性和公正性2.评估方法包括分析算法在处理不同群体数据时的表现差异,如性别、年龄、种族等3.随着算法在关键领域中的应用,公平性评估成为确保算法正确性和社会接受度的关键环节数据安全与隐私保护,检验结果溯源算法研究,数据安全与隐私保护,数据加密技术,1.采用先进的加密算法,如AES(高级加密标准)和RSA(公钥加密),确保数据在存储和传输过程中的安全性2.对敏感数据进行分层加密,结合对称加密和非对称加密,提高数据加密的复杂度和安全性3.定期更新加密密钥,采用密钥管理策略,确保密钥的安全性和唯一性匿名化处理,1.在数据溯源过程中,对个人身份信息进行匿名化处理,如脱敏、哈希等,保护个人隐私2.采用差分隐私技术,在保证数据可用性的同时,降低数据泄露的风险3.对匿名化数据进行严格的审计和监控,确保匿名化处理的有效性和合规性。
数据安全与隐私保护,访问控制策略,1.建立严格的访问控制机制,确保只有授权用户才能访问敏感数据2.实施最小权限原则,用户只能访问完成其工作职责所必需的数据3.对访问行为进行实时监控和记录,以便在发生安全事件时能够迅。












